Vagamon Population - Idukki, Kerala

Vagamon is a large village located in Peerumade Taluka of Idukki district, Kerala with total 3816 families residing. The Vagamon village has population of 14641 of which 7212 are males while 7429 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Vagamon village population of children with age 0-6 is 1316 which makes up 8.99 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Vagamon village is 1030 which is lower than Kerala state average of 1084. Child Sex Ratio for the Vagamon as per census is 976, higher than Kerala average of 964.

Vagamon village has lower literacy rate compared to Kerala. In 2011, literacy rate of Vagamon village was 90.88 % compared to 94.00 % of Kerala. In Vagamon Male literacy stands at 94.91 % while female literacy rate was 86.99 %.

Vagamon Data

Particulars Total Male Female
Total No. of Houses 3,816 - -
Population 14,641 7,212 7,429
Child (0-6) 1,316 666 650
Schedule Caste 3,275 1,592 1,683
Schedule Tribe 310 148 162
Literacy 90.88 % 94.91 % 86.99 %
Total Workers 7,644 4,369 3,275
Main Worker 6,296 - -
Marginal Worker 1,348 579 769

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 22.37 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 2.12 % of total population in Vagamon village.

Work Profile

In Vagamon village out of total population, 7644 were engaged in work activities. 82.37 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 17.63 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 7644 workers engaged in Main Work, 885 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1407 were Agricultural labourer.
